Your new roleAs a Senior Building Surveyor, you will play a pivotal role in leading a building surveying team and overseeing delivery of projects, refurbishments, and refits. You will be responsible for devising and implementing a planned maintenance schedule, ensuring effective execution of PPM schedules, and maintaining the highest standards of compliance and safety. Your strong leadership skills will help to drive the success of projects forwards, guiding and supporting building surveyors within your team throughout. What you'll need to succeed

  • Excellent experience and expertise in building surveying.
  • Strong team leadership skills with the ability to inspire and guide your team.
  • Expertise in the delivery of small projects, refurbishments, and refits.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
